During my trip to Budapest, I decided to visit the opera to take a closer look at it during a guided tour and it was an interesting experience to look a little behind the scenes. The guided tours take place regularly and can be visited in different languages and I especially liked that they are led by different leaders and the visitors are not dependent on an audio guide, which makes the tour comfortable in every respect and the different tour guides divide themselves so that each group is alone for itself and can visit the rooms in peace without being confused by the other languages. The tickets can be purchased online or directly on site and cost 9000 HU for each person, which corresponds to about 22 $ and the tour lasted a total of 60 minutes, which also includes a small performance in which the delightful art form is presented in more detail and brings people more to the taste to visit a whole performance. In Hungary it's one of the most famous houses which is located in the district of Pest and is also considered one of the most popular in all of Europe which attracts thousands of visitors every year due to the breathtaking architecture in Renaissance style.

The building was designed by the architect Miklós Ybl (1814 - 1891) who received a lot of recognition for his buildings in his life and was even once knighted and this opera house is probably his best known work which was built during the 19th century and the construction took almost ten years. During construction, emphasis was always placed on the quality of all materials and he was very unique in this respect and placed extremely high demands on them and both outside and inside many different elements can be observed which expresses the diversity well. The building is richly decorated with various elements which can be associated with the Baroque era and there are also many traces of Greek mythology and during the construction there was also talk of the opera house in Vienna and to this day, the opera is considered one of the most important sights of the city in which various pieces are regularly performed.
